Amancio Ortega, born as Amancio Ortega Gaona, is a Spanish business tycoon best recognized as the founder of the Inditex fashion group, the parent company of the famous fashion brand ZARA, which has more than 7,000 stores in over 90 countries. As of January 2018, Ortega had an estimated net worth of about $77.6 billion, making him the richest man in Europe and the fourth richest in the world at the time. He is also regarded as the wealthiest retailer in the world. Ortega, who earns more than $400 million in dividends annually, has investments in an extensive real estate portfolio that includes properties in cities such as New York, Miami, London, Barcelona, Chicago, and Madrid. The Spanish entrepreneur is known to be media-shy. This is why many people are unaware of him despite his role as the founder of one of the world’s leading fashion labels.

Amancio Ortega began his career as a shop hand for a shirt maker called Gala and learned to make clothes by hand. He then founded Confecciones Goa in 1972, and began selling quilted bathrobes. Three years later, he, along with his first wife, Rosalía, opened the first Zara store. The store was a success and this motivated Ortega to open several more Zara stores across Spain in the following decade. The label Zara is part of the Inditex group.
Amancio Ortega was born on March 28, 1936, in Busdongo de Arbás, León, Spain, to Antonio Ortega Rodríguez and Josefa Gaona Hernández as the youngest of their four kids. He spent his childhood days in León. At the age of 14, he left his school and moved to A Coruña due to his father’s job.
